Overview

World Sauntering Day, observed annually on June 19th, encourages people to slow down and enjoy a leisurely, mindful walk. Established in 1979 by W.T. Rabe on Mackinac Island, Michigan, it was conceived as an antidote to the then-popular National Running Day, promoting the appreciation of one's surroundings at a relaxed pace rather than rushing through life.
